Gifting for groups requires balancing individual preferences with collective logistics. Effective strategies make the process joyful and inclusive.

Assessing Group Dynamics and Preferences

Understanding the composition, size, and diversity of the group or team guides gifting decisions. Noting cultural backgrounds, age ranges, and personal interests helps identify common denominators for appropriate gifts. Consulting group leaders or representatives can clarify expectations and restrictions, ensuring inclusivity and acceptance. A thoughtful approach maximizes relevance and respect while minimizing potential conflicts or dissatisfaction.

Acknowledging diverse tastes means considering neutral or universally appealing gifts that avoid alienation. Recognizing the purpose and tone of the occasion—celebratory, appreciation, or ceremonial—also influences suitable selections.

Budgeting and Coordinating Contributions

Establishing a clear, fair budget shared among members prevents financial stress and confusion. Coordinating contributions transparently builds trust and equitable participation. Group gifting stations or pooled funds facilitate larger or more meaningful presents than individual budgets allow.

Providing budget tiers and options accommodates varied financial capacities. Clear communication about expectations and deadlines ensures smooth planning and execution.

Selecting Gifts That Foster Team Spirit

Gifts that promote unity, such as branded apparel, office gear, or shared experiences, strengthen group identity and camaraderie. Personalization elements like team logos or individual names create a sense of belonging and recognition. These gifts serve dual purposes of utility and morale boosting.

Flexible gift options that accommodate individual differences (like color choices or sizes) show respect for diversity while maintaining cohesion. Thoughtful gifts foster motivation and collective pride, enhancing group performance and satisfaction.

Organizing Distribution and Presentation

Planning an organized distribution method—whether at events or staggered deliveries—prevents confusion and ensures everyone receives gifts timely. Coordinating group presentations can enhance excitement and appreciation. Virtual or hybrid gifting occasions require innovative planning to maintain inclusivity and connection.

Including personalized notes or acknowledgments during distribution adds warmth. Attention to logistics reflects care and professionalism, contributing to a positive gifting experience.

Maintaining Flexibility and Feedback

Remaining open to feedback and adaptable to changing group dynamics supports continued success in group gifting. Surveys or informal discussions provide insights for improvement. Recognizing individual efforts and preferences fosters goodwill and participation.

Continuous communication and reflection improve processes and outcomes, making group gifting a positive tradition that evolves constructively.
